In this role, you will be responsible for safeguarding system-level integrity across defense projects, ensuring that complex technical solutions are coherent, compliant, and fit for purpose in a regulated environment.
What will you be doing?
Lead and manage all system engineering activities in accordance with Aker Solutions’ engineering policies and governance framework
Define, maintain, and safeguard system architecture and overall technical integrity across projects
Translate customer, operational, and regulatory requirements into robust, compliant system solutions
Lead system level integration, verification, and validation activities across engineering disciplines
Ensure system documentation, configuration control, and compliance with applicable standards and defense requirements
Secure system performance in line with defined reliability, availability, and safety requirements
Act as the technical focal point across engineering disciplines, Project Management, and key stakeholders
Identify, manage, and mitigate system level and integration risks throughout the project lifecycle
